Manipur unrest: As RS chair shuts door, Oppn asks Prez to step in

Rule 267 allows for suspension of the listed business for the day to discuss an issue suggested by a member

Rajya Sabha Chairman Jagdeep Dhankhar on Wednesday said he cannot issue a directive to the prime minister to come to the House.

Opposition leaders have been demanding a discussion under Rule 267 of Rajya Sabha. Dhankhar said he had received 58 notices under Rule 267 demanding a discussion on the Manipur unrest. He, however, did not accept the notices saying they were not in order.
